Journeys of Hope – Central Library Book Launch

Join us to celebrate the launch of Journeys of Hope: Challenging Discrimination and Building on Vancouver Chinatown’s Legacies! Created through a continued partnership between the City of Vancouver and the University of British Columbia, this book is an indication of both partners’ commitments to collaboratively plan and develop a UNESCO World Heritage Status application for Vancouver’s Chinatown.

This edition builds on the commemorative version unveiled at the Vancouver City Council’s special meeting in Chinatown on April 22, 2018, capturing the historical moment when the City formally apologized for its past involvement in the discrimination and racism against early Chinese Canadian immigrants and their families.

Written in both English and Chinese, Journeys of Hope reaffirms the importance of multilingual engagement in community building, outreach, and education.
